5 Things to do in Montreal

Sitting at the centre of French culture outside of France due to its status as the economic centre of Quebec and the fact that it is the largest French metropolis in the world apart from the mother country, Montreal is a world away culturally from the rest of Canada. The most historic casinos to visit in Monte Carlo!

exterior of monte carlo casino There are several amazing casinos in Monte Carlo, as you would expect from a resort that has traditionally rivaled Las Vegas as the quintesential home of the casino, but there are two that stand out for the level of historic interest they offer. Both the Casino de Monte Carlo and the Casino Café de Paris rank amongst the world’s oldest casinos, and both boast the sort of history that can make them appealing even to those who aren’t particularly interested in slot machines or table games.
